Rajnath Singh meets U.S. Senators Ted Cruz and Maggie Hassan in Delhi
Defence Minister Rajnath Singh met U.S. Senators Ted Cruz and Maggie Hassan in New Delhi today. He spoke about ways to further strengthen India-U.S. relations.

Defence Minister Rajnath Singh on Friday met prominent US politicians, Senators Ted Cruz and Maggie Hassan in New Delhi. The meeting was also attended by US Ambassador to India, Mr. Kenneth Juster and officials of the Ministry of Defence.

During the meeting between the Defence Minister and the US Senators, Rajnath Singh expressed his satisfaction over the progress made in the partnership between India and America. Singh also discussed ways to further strengthen the bilateral defence relationship between India and the U.S.

Rajnath Singh appreciates the role of U.S. in countering terrorism
During the meeting, Rajnath Singh termed America as the world’s oldest democracy and India's one of the most important and trusted partners. Applauding the growth of India- U.S. cooperation in the last five years, Rajnath Singh expressed hope in the expansion of the strategic partnership between both the countries to expand and flourish in the upcoming years. Rajnath Singh also appreciated the role played by the U.S. in countering terrorism. Adding further, Singh restated the Government of India’s commitment to work with the international community in combating the menace plaguing the world.

India- France Defence Dialogue
During his recent visit to France, Defence minister Rajnath Singh had concluded the annual India-France Defence Dialogue with French Armed Forces Minister Florence Parly in Paris recently. Enhanced strategic ties were on top of his agenda during the dialogue. During his visit, he also participated in the hand-over ceremony of the Rafale Jet. The Defence Minister also took a 25-minute long sortie in India's first Rafale Jet.
